The Lunar Prospector Electron Reflectometer (LP-ER) Level 1B Omni-directional 3D Electron Flux Data (ER_3D) data products are a time ordered series of 3D spectrum electron measurements. Each record consists of a time tag with an 88x15 array of scalar data points representing measurements of the electron flux in 88 solid angles covering 4pi steradians and 15 energy channels logarithmically spaced from 10 eV to 20 keV, with an energy resolution (dE/E) of 25%. Each data point is a measure of the electron flux (cm-2s-1ster-1eV-1) within one of the 88 approximately equal-sized solid angles.

Angles are given in despun spacecraft (SCD) coordinates, in which the Z-axis coincides with the spacecraft spin vector, and the direction of the sun is in the half plane defined by X > 0, Y = 0. These data records are accumulated during ½ spin of the spacecraft (~2.5 seconds) and sampled every 16 spins (~80 seconds). For convenience, the average magnetic field vector during the ~2.5 second accumulation time is provided to facilitate calculation of electron pitch angle distributions from the 3D data.

Each of the 88 solid angle bins are approximately the same size. The exact sizes are given below.

ER_3D products have the following file names:

3Dyymmdd.TAB (with detached PDS label)

where:

yy = year of data collection

mm = month of data collection

dd = day of data collection

Additionally, there are 2 ancillary files in this dataset. Theta.tab, with its corresponding label file, gives the polar angle of the detector as it steps within each spectrum. These values do not change with time. Outages.tab, with its corresponding label file, lists times and information about data gaps our outages in Lunar Prospector merged telemetry files for the entire LP mission.
